Linux系统安装指南:从选型到优化,打造专属高效工作环境183
作为一名资深操作系统专家,我深知选择并正确安装一个操作系统是构建高效、稳定工作环境的第一步。在当今多元化的操作系统生态中,Linux凭借其开源、稳定、安全、高度可定制等优势,日益受到开发者、IT专业人士乃至普通用户的青睐。然而,对于许多初学者而言,Linux的安装过程可能显得复杂而充满挑战。本文旨在提供一份全面的Linux系统安装推荐指南,涵盖从前期准备、发行版选择、安装方式到后期优化与常见问题排查的全过程,助您轻松驾驭Linux世界。
1. 为什么选择Linux?:理解其核心价值
在深入探讨安装细节之前,我们首先需要理解Linux为何值得被选择。它的核心价值在于:
    开源与免费: Linux内核及其绝大多数发行版都是开源的,这意味着您可以免费获取、使用、修改和分发,极大地降低了软件成本。
    稳定性与安全性: Linux在服务器领域占据主导地位,其稳定性久经考验。完善的权限管理和活跃的社区使其在安全性方面表现出色,相对不易受到病毒和恶意软件的攻击。
    高性能与效率: Linux系统对硬件资源的要求相对较低,能够更有效地利用系统资源,尤其在旧电脑上能焕发第二春。
    高度可定制性: 从桌面环境(GNOME, KDE, XFCE等)到底层系统配置,Linux提供了无与伦比的定制自由度,您可以根据个人喜好和需求打造独一无二的操作系统。
    强大的命令行工具: 对于开发者和系统管理员而言,Linux的命令行界面(CLI)提供了极其强大的管理和自动化能力。
    活跃的社区支持: 遇到问题时,庞大的全球Linux社区能够提供丰富的资源和及时的帮助。
2. 安装前的准备工作:磨刀不误砍柴工
充分的准备是成功安装Linux的关键。忽视这些步骤可能导致数据丢失或安装失败。
    硬件兼容性检查: 尽管Linux兼容性广泛,但仍建议检查您的特定硬件(尤其是无线网卡、显卡等)是否被良好支持。大多数主流硬件在现代发行版中都有良好的驱动支持。
    数据备份: 这是最重要的一步。无论是单系统安装还是双系统共存,都强烈建议您备份所有重要数据到外部存储设备,以防万一。
    制作启动盘:
        
            下载ISO镜像: 从您选择的Linux发行版官方网站下载对应的ISO文件。
            选择介质: 通常是USB闪存盘(推荐8GB或更大容量)或DVD。
            制作工具: 在Windows下,推荐使用Rufus或Etcher;在macOS下,推荐使用Etcher或UNetbootin;在Linux下,可以直接使用dd命令或Etcher。
        
    
    BIOS/UEFI设置:
        
            禁用Secure Boot(安全启动): 许多Linux发行版不支持UEFI的Secure Boot功能。
            禁用Fast Boot(快速启动): 在Windows中禁用此功能,以避免在双系统时引起硬盘访问问题。
            调整启动顺序: 将USB驱动器或DVD设置为第一启动项,以便从制作好的启动盘引导。
            SATA模式: 确保SATA控制器模式设置为AHCI,而不是RAID或IDE模式。
        
    
    硬盘分区规划(尤其对于双系统):
        
            Windows分区调整: 如果计划与Windows双系统共存,您需要在Windows下使用磁盘管理工具压缩出一个未分配空间,用于安装Linux。不要直接删除Windows分区。
            Linux分区建议:
                
                    EFI系统分区 (ESP): 如果是UEFI启动,必须有一个FAT32格式的ESP,挂载点为/boot/efi。如果Windows已存在ESP,可以直接使用。
                    根分区 (/): Linux系统的主体,建议分配20-50GB。文件系统通常为Ext4。
                    Home分区 (/home): 用户数据和配置文件的存储位置,建议分配50GB或更大,独立分区便于系统重装时保留个人数据。文件系统通常为Ext4。
                    Swap分区 (交换分区): 虚拟内存,传统建议大小为物理内存的1-2倍。现代系统内存充裕时,也可以使用Swap文件代替,或分配较小空间(例如4-8GB)。
                    Boot分区 (/boot): 如果您的主分区很大或使用LVM/加密,可能需要一个独立的/boot分区(500MB-1GB),但对于大多数用户而言,可以合并到根分区。
                
            
        
    
3. 选择合适的Linux发行版:因需而异
Linux发行版众多,选择一款适合自己的至关重要。以下是一些常见发行版及其推荐场景:
    新手入门级:
        
            Ubuntu: 最受欢迎的发行版之一,拥有庞大的社区、丰富的软件源和详细的文档。安装简便,桌面环境(GNOME)美观易用,是初学者的不二之选。
            Linux Mint: 基于Ubuntu,旨在提供更友好的桌面体验,尤其适合从Windows迁移的用户。提供Cinnamon、MATE、XFCE等多种桌面环境选择。
            Pop!_OS: 由System76公司开发,基于Ubuntu,针对开发者和创作者优化。界面美观,预装NVIDIA驱动,对笔记本用户体验友好。
        
    
    进阶用户/开发者:
        
            Debian: Ubuntu的“上游”,以稳定性、安全性和纯粹性著称。软件更新相对保守,但极其稳定,适合服务器和追求长期稳定性的用户。
            Fedora: Red Hat的社区版,更新速度快,引入最新技术,是体验Linux前沿技术的理想选择。适合喜欢尝试新功能和追求高性能的开发者。
            Arch Linux: “滚键盘”发行版,提供了极高的定制自由度,但安装和配置过程相对复杂,适合对Linux有深入了解并乐于动手折腾的用户。其Wiki是学习Linux的宝库。
        
    
    特定用途:
        
            CentOS Stream/RHEL: 服务器级操作系统,以其企业级支持和稳定性闻名。适合部署生产环境。
            Kali Linux: 专注于信息安全和渗透测试的发行版,预装了大量安全工具。不推荐作为日常桌面系统使用。
        
    
选择考量因素: 除了用户经验,还应考虑桌面环境(DE)、包管理器(APT, DNF, Pacman)、社区活跃度、软件生态以及发布周期(LTS长期支持版 vs. 滚动更新版)。
4. 安装方式:灵活多样的选择
根据您的需求和现有环境,可以选择不同的安装方式:
    物理机单系统安装: 清除硬盘上所有数据,只安装Linux。这是最纯粹、性能最好的方式,适合全新电脑或彻底放弃原有系统的用户。
    双系统共存(Dual Boot): 在同一台电脑上安装Linux和Windows(或macOS),每次启动时选择进入哪个系统。这是最常见的安装方式,既能保留Windows常用软件,又能体验Linux。
    虚拟机安装(Virtual Machine): 在现有操作系统(如Windows/macOS)中,通过虚拟机软件(如VirtualBox、VMware Workstation/Fusion)安装Linux。优点是安全无风险,易于测试和学习,不影响物理机系统。缺点是性能不如物理机。
    WSL (Windows Subsystem for Linux): 针对Windows用户,WSL允许在Windows环境下运行一个完整的Linux内核和用户空间,无需双启动或虚拟机。适合需要Linux命令行工具进行开发,但不希望完全脱离Windows桌面的用户。
    Live USB体验: 在不安装系统的情况下,直接从USB启动盘运行Linux。这是一种安全、无损的体验方式,可以帮助您在安装前测试硬件兼容性、桌面环境和系统性能。
5. 详细安装流程与关键步骤
以Ubuntu为例,通用安装流程如下:
    从启动盘引导: 将制作好的启动盘插入电脑,开机进入BIOS/UEFI设置,选择从USB/DVD启动。
    选择语言与试用/安装: 进入Ubuntu桌面环境后,您可以选择“Try Ubuntu”进行体验,或直接点击“Install Ubuntu”开始安装。
    准备安装:
        
            键盘布局: 选择合适的键盘布局。
            网络连接: 连接到Wi-Fi或有线网络,以便在安装过程中下载更新。
            更新与第三方软件: 勾选“下载更新”和“安装第三方软件”(包括图形、Wi-Fi硬件和媒体格式驱动)。
        
    
    安装类型: 这是最关键的一步。
        
            “清除磁盘并安装Ubuntu”: 适用于单系统安装,会删除硬盘上所有数据。请谨慎选择!
            “与其他操作系统并存”: 如果检测到Windows,会显示此选项,安装向导会尝试自动分区。
            “其他选项”(Something else): 推荐用于双系统或高级用户自定义分区。 在此界面,您可以手动创建、修改、删除分区,并设置挂载点(/, /home, /boot/efi, swap等)。
        
    
    选择时区与用户账户: 设置您的地理位置和时区,然后创建用户名、密码和计算机名称。
    等待安装完成: 安装过程通常需要15-30分钟,具体取决于硬件性能和网络速度。
    重启: 安装完成后,系统会提示您重启。请拔出启动盘,电脑将从硬盘引导进入新安装的Linux系统。
6. 安装后的优化与配置
系统安装完成后,并非一劳永逸。适当的优化和配置能显著提升使用体验。
    系统更新: 立即进行系统更新是首要任务。打开终端,输入sudo apt update && sudo apt upgrade -y(对于Debian/Ubuntu系)或相应命令。
    驱动程序安装: 尤其是NVIDIA/AMD显卡驱动、无线网卡驱动等。在Ubuntu中,可以通过“软件和更新”中的“额外驱动”选项进行安装。
    常用软件安装:
        
            浏览器: Chrome/Firefox。
            办公套件: LibreOffice(通常预装)或WPS Office。
            媒体播放器: VLC Media Player。
            压缩工具: Rar/Unzip。
            开发工具: VS Code, Docker, Git等。
        
    
    桌面环境个性化: 根据喜好安装主题、图标包、字体,调整桌面布局、壁纸等。
    系统安全设置: 开启防火墙(如UFW),配置SSH(如果需要远程访问),定期检查系统日志。
    电源管理: 针对笔记本电脑,安装TLP等工具优化电池续航。
7. 常见问题与排查
在Linux安装和使用过程中,可能会遇到以下问题:
    GRUB引导问题: 双系统安装后无法进入Windows或Linux。通常可以通过启动到Live USB,使用Boot-Repair工具修复GRUB。
    无线网卡/显卡驱动问题: 导致无法上网或显示分辨率异常。检查驱动程序是否安装正确,或尝试从官方网站下载适用于Linux的驱动。
    系统卡顿/性能不佳: 检查系统资源占用情况(htop命令),确保没有过多后台进程。考虑更换轻量级桌面环境。
    硬盘空间不足: 定期清理不必要的软件包(sudo apt autoremove),检查日志文件大小,或扩展分区。
    软件安装失败: 检查软件源配置是否正确,网络连接是否正常,或尝试通过Flatpak/Snap等通用包格式安装。
    寻求帮助: 充分利用发行版的官方论坛、Stack Overflow、Reddit等社区资源,提问时提供详细的错误信息和系统配置。
结语
安装Linux系统是一个充满探索和学习的过程。从选择合适的发行版到精细化分区,再到安装后的个性化配置和优化,每一步都蕴含着丰富的操作系统专业知识。希望这份详细的指南能帮助您扫清障碍,顺利踏入Linux的精彩世界。请记住,Linux的魅力在于其无限的可能性和活跃的社区支持,不要害怕尝试和犯错,每一次解决问题都是一次宝贵的成长。祝您在Linux的旅程中,收获一个稳定、高效且充满乐趣的工作环境!
2025-11-04

